Tracheal intubation poses a high risk of infection to medical staff due to Coronavirus disease 2019 (COVID-19) highly infectious nature. To mitigate this risk, various medical devices, including video laryngoscopy, have been developed to assist intubation. This study compared conventional laryngoscopy (Macintosh) and disposable video laryngoscopes (Medcaptain VS-10s and Honestmc Laryngoscope_LA10000) in terms of their use and operation processes. We designed a questionnaire to assess the operator perception of performing intubation with the devices, and statistical analysis was performed on 50 clinical staff members from 2 hospitals who had performed intubation or had learned intubation techniques. The primary outcomes were time to glottic visualization, intubation time, intubation success rate, distance between the operator and training model, and time from glottic visualization to tube insertion. The secondary outcomes were as follows: overall laryngoscope quality, operative feel, maneuverability, ease of use, and video quality. This study showed that video laryngoscopes were superior to conventional laryngoscopes in terms of quality, operative feel, and ease of use. When LA10000 was employed, the intubation success rate was higher, and the operator risk of infection was lower because of the greater distance from the training model. However, the use of video laryngoscopes requires appropriate education and training use of the devices. This study also demonstrated that when participants viewed a simple operation video prior to using video laryngoscopes, tube insertion time was shorter. Overall, video laryngoscopy can provide a safer and more convenient option for clinical medical personnel during pandemics.

BACKGROUND: Endotracheal intubation is challenging during cardiopulmonary resuscitation, and video laryngoscopy has showed benefits for this procedure. The aim of this study was to compare the effectiveness of various intubation approaches, including the bougie first, preloaded bougie, endotracheal tube (ETT) with stylet, and ETT without stylet, on first-attempt success using video laryngoscopy during chest compression. METHODS: This was a randomized crossover trial conducted in a general tertiary teaching hospital. We included anesthesia residents in postgraduate year one to three who passed the screening test. Each resident performed intubation with video laryngoscopy using the four approaches in a randomized sequence on an adult manikin during continuous chest compression. The primary outcome was the first-attempt success defined as starting ventilation within a one minute. RESULTS: A total of 260 endotracheal intubations conducted by 65 residents were randomized and analyzed with 65 procedures in each group. First-attempt success occurred in 64 (98.5%), 57 (87.7%), 56 (86.2%), and 46 (70.8%) intubations in the bougie-first, preloaded bougie, ETT with stylet, and ETT without stylet approaches, respectively. The bougie-first approach had a significantly higher possibility of first-attempt success than the preloaded bougie approach [risk ratio (RR) 8.00, 95% confidence interval (CI) 1.03 to 62.16, P = 0.047], the ETT with stylet approach (RR 9.00, 95% CI 1.17 to 69.02, P = 0.035), and the ETT without stylet approach (RR 19.00, 95% CI 2.62 to 137.79, P = 0.004) in the generalized estimating equation logistic model accounting for clustering of intubations operated by the same resident. In addition, the bougie first approach did not result in prolonged intubation or increased self-reported difficulty among the study participants. CONCLUSIONS: The bougie first approach with video laryngoscopy had the highest possibility of first-attempt success during chest compression. These results helped inform the intubation approach during CPR. However, further studies in an actual clinical environment are warranted to validate these findings. BACKGROUND: Repeated attempts at endotracheal intubation are associated with increased adverse events in neonates. When clinicians view the airway directly with a laryngoscope, fewer than half of first attempts are successful. The use of a video laryngoscope, which has a camera at the tip of the blade that displays a view of the airway on a screen, has been associated with a greater percentage of successful intubations on the first attempt than the use of direct laryngoscopy in adults and children. The effect of video laryngoscopy among neonates is uncertain. METHODS: In this single-center trial, we randomly assigned neonates of any gestational age who were undergoing intubation in the delivery room or neonatal intensive care unit (NICU) to the video-laryngoscopy group or the direct-laryngoscopy group. Randomization was stratified according to gestational age (<32 weeks or ≥32 weeks). The primary outcome was successful intubation on the first attempt, as determined by exhaled carbon dioxide detection. RESULTS: Data were analyzed for 214 of the 226 neonates who were enrolled in the trial, 63 (29%) of whom were intubated in the delivery room and 151 (71%) in the NICU. Successful intubation on the first attempt occurred in 79 of the 107 patients (74%; 95% confidence interval [CI], 66 to 82) in the video-laryngoscopy group and in 48 of the 107 patients (45%; 95% CI, 35 to 54) in the direct-laryngoscopy group (P<0.001). The median number of attempts to achieve successful intubation was 1 (95% CI, 1 to 1) in the video-laryngoscopy group and 2 (95% CI, 1 to 2) in the direct-laryngoscopy group. The median lowest oxygen saturation during intubation was 74% (95% CI, 65 to 78) in the video-laryngoscopy group and 68% (95% CI, 62 to 74) in the direct-laryngoscopy group; the lowest heart rate was 153 beats per minute (95% CI, 148 to 158) and 148 (95% CI, 140 to 156), respectively. CONCLUSIONS: Among neonates undergoing urgent endotracheal intubation, video laryngoscopy resulted in a greater number of successful intubations on the first attempt than direct laryngoscopy. OBJECTIVE: To develop and evaluate a low-cost three-dimensional (3D)-printed video laryngoscope (VLVET) for use with a commercial borescope. STUDY DESIGN: Instrument development and pilot study. ANIMALS: A total of six adult male Beagle dogs. METHODS: The VLVET consisted of a laryngoscope handle and a Miller-type blade, and a detachable camera holder that attached to various locations along the blade. The laryngoscope and camera holder were 3D-printed using black polylactic acid filament. Dogs were premedicated with intravenous (IV) medetomidine (15 µg kg-1) and anesthesia induced with IV alfaxalone (1.5 mg kg-1). The VLVET, combined with a borescope, was used for laryngeal visualization and intubation. Performance was evaluated by comparing direct and video-assisted views in sternal recumbency. The borescope camera was sequentially positioned at 2, 4, 6, 8 and 10 cm from the blade tip (distanceLARYNX-CAM), which was placed on the epiglottis during intubation or laryngoscopy. At the 10 cm distanceLARYNX-CAM, laryngeal visualization was sequentially scored at inter-incisor gaps of 10, 8, 6, 4 and 2 cm. Laryngeal visualization scores (0-3 range, with 0 = obstructed and 3 = unobstructed views) were statistically analyzed using the Friedman's test. RESULTS: Under direct visualization, the 2 cm distanceLARYNX-CAM had a significantly lower score compared with all other distanceLARYNX-CAM (all p = 0.014) because the view was obstructed by the camera holder and borescope camera. With both direct and camera-assisted views, visualization scores were higher at inter-incisor gaps ≥ 4 cm compared with 2 cm (all p < 0.05). CONCLUSIONS AND CLINICAL RELEVANCE: During laryngoscopy and intubation, the VLVET and borescope facilitated both direct and video laryngoscopy at distanceLARYNX-CAM in Beagle dogs when inter-incisor gaps were ≥ 4 cm.

INTRODUCTION: This systematic review and meta-analysis aimed to compare the efficacy of dynamic versus standard bougies to achieve tracheal intubation. METHODS: We searched MEDLINE, Embase, CENTRAL, Web of Science, Scopus and Google Scholar on 10 October 2023. We included clinical trials comparing both devices. The primary outcome was the first-attempt intubation success rate. The secondary outcome was the time required for tracheal intubation. RESULTS: Eighteen studies were included. Dynamic bougies do not increase first-attempt success rate (RR 1.11; p = 0.06) or shorten tracheal intubation time (MD -0.30 sec; p = 0.84) in clinical trials in humans. In difficult airways, first-attempt success intubation rate was greater for dynamic bougies (RR 1.17; p = 0.002); Additionally, they reduced the time required for intubation (MD -4.80 sec; p = 0.001). First-attempt intubation success rate was higher (RR 1.15; p = 0.01) and time to achieve intubation was shorter when using Macintosh blades combined with dynamic bougies (MD -5.38 sec; p < 0.00001). Heterogeneity was high. CONCLUSION: Dynamic bougies do not increase the overall first-pass success rate or shorten tracheal intubation time. However, dynamic bougies seem to improve first-attempt tracheal intubation rate in patients with difficult airways and in those intubated with a Macintosh blade. Further research is needed for definitive conclusions. REGISTRATION OF PROSPERO: CRD42023472122.

OBJECTIVE: Tracheal intubation in cardiac surgery patients has a higher incidence of difficult laryngoscopic views compared with patients undergoing other types of surgery. The authors hypothesized that using the McGrath Mac videolaryngoscope as the first intubation option for cardiac surgery patients improves the percentage of patients with "easy intubation" compared with using a direct Macintosh laryngoscope. DESIGN: A prospective, observational, before-after study. SETTING: At a tertiary-care hospital. PARTICIPANTS: One thousand one hundred nine patients undergoing cardiac surgery. INTERVENTION: Consecutive patients undergoing cardiac surgery were intubated using, as the first option, a Macintosh laryngoscope (preinterventional phase) or a McGrath Mac videolaryngoscope (interventional phase). MEASUREMENTS AND MAIN RESULTS: The main objective was to assess whether the use of the McGrath videolaryngoscope, as the first intubation option, improves the percentage of patients with "easy intubation," defined as successful intubation on the first attempt, modified Cormack-Lehane grades of I or IIa, and the absence of the need for adjuvant airway devices. A total of 1,109 patients were included, 801 in the noninterventional phase and 308 in the interventional phase. The incidence of "easy intubation" was 93% in the interventional phase versus 78% in the noninterventional phase (p < 0.001). First-success-rate intubation was higher in the interventional phase (304/308; 98.7%) compared with the noninterventional phase (754/801, 94.1%; p = 0.005). Intubation in the interventional phase showed decreases in the incidence of difficult laryngoscopy (12/308 [3.9%] v 157/801 [19.6%]; p < 0.001), as well as moderate or difficult intubation (5/308 [1.6%] v 57/801 [7.1%]; p < 0.001). CONCLUSIONS: The use of the McGrath videolaryngoscope as the first intubation option for tracheal intubation in cardiac surgery improves the percentage of patients with "easy" intubation," increasing glottic view and first-success-rate intubation and decreasing the incidence of moderate or difficult intubation.

BACKGROUND: Pediatric airway management requires careful clinical evaluation and experienced execution due to anatomical, physiological, and developmental considerations. Video laryngoscopy in pediatric airways is a developing area of research, with recent data suggesting that video laryngoscopes are better than standard Macintosh blades. Specifically, there is a paucity of literature on the advantages of the C-MAC D-blade compared to the McCoy direct laryngoscope. METHODS: After Ethics Committee approval, 70 American Society of Anesthesiologists physical status 1 and 2 children aged 4-12 years scheduled for elective surgery under general anesthesia were recruited. Patients were randomly allocated to intubation using a C-MAC video laryngoscope size 2 D-blade (Group 1) and a McCoy laryngoscope size 2 blade (Group 2). The Intubation Difficulty Scale (IDS) for ease of intubation was the primary outcome, while Cormack-Lehane grades, duration of laryngoscopy and intubation, hemodynamic responses, and incidence of any airway complications were secondary outcomes. RESULTS: Both groups were comparable in terms of patient characteristics. The median (IQR) Intubation Difficulty Scale (IDS) score was better but was statistically nonsignificant with C-MAC (0 [0-0] vs. 0 [0-2], p = .055). The glottic views were superior (CL grade I in 32/35 vs. 23/35, p = .002), and the time to best glottic view (6 s [5-7] vs. 8.0 s [6-10], p = .006) was lesser in the C-MAC D-blade group while the total duration of intubation was comparable (20 s [16-22] vs. 18 s [15-22], p = .374). All the patients could be successfully intubated on the first attempt. None of the patients had any complications. CONCLUSION: The C-MAC video laryngoscope size 2 D-blade provided faster and better glottic visualization but similar intubation difficulty compared to McCoy size 2 laryngoscope in children. The shorter time to achieve glottic view demonstrated with the C-MAC failed to translate into a shorter total duration of intubation when compared to the McCoy laryngoscope attributable to a pronounced curvature of the D-blade.

Upper Aerodigestive Tract Endoscopy (UATE) is recommended for initial examination of head and neck squamous cell carcinomas. Reducing delay of initial examination must be a challenge to manage head and neck cancers. We hereby describe the technic combining UATE and flexible endoscopy in a unique general anesthesia with overview of hypopharyngeal, larygeal, tracheal, esophageal, nasopharyngeal sub sites in a unique procedure with system of magnificense and to perform percutaneous gastrostomy during the same time before initiation of therapy.

BACKGROUND: Vocal cord polyps are commonly encountered in the otorhinolaryngology department. The risk of anesthesia is high in patients with large vocal cord polyps. Awake intubation with appropriate airway tools provides a favorable safety profile. CASE: We present the case of a 60-year-old male patient who had been suffering from a large vocal cord polyp for 16 years. Electronic laryngoscopy revealed that the vocal cord polyp was approximately 1.5 cm in diameter. The polyp had a pedicle and demonstrated synchronous motion with respiratory excursion. It covered almost the entire glottic area during inspiration and moved away from the glottis during expiration. A Disposcope endoscope was used for awake tracheal intubation, and the surgery was completed successfully. CONCLUSIONS: The Disposcope endoscope can be a useful option for awake orotracheal intubation in cases of anticipated difficult intubation and difficult facemask ventilation.

INTRODUCTION: Video laryngoscope (VL) technology improves first-pass success. The novel i-view VL device is inexpensive and disposable. We sought to determine the first-pass intubation success with the i-view VL device versus the standard reusable VL systems in routine use at each site. METHODS: We performed a prospective, pragmatic study at two major emergency departments (EDs) when VL was used. We rotated i-view versus reusable VL as the preferred device of the month based on an a priori schedule. An investigator-initiated interim analysis was performed. Our primary outcome was a first-pass success with a non-inferiority margin of 10% based on the per-protocol analysis. RESULTS: There were 93 intubations using the reusable VL devices and 81 intubations using the i-view. Our study was stopped early due to futility in reaching our predetermined non-inferiority margin. Operator and patient characteristics were similar between the two groups. The first-pass success rate for the i-view group was 69.1% compared to 84.3% for the reusable VL group. A non-inferiority analysis indicated that the difference (-15.1%) and corresponding 90% confidence limits (-25.3% to -5.0%) did not fall within the predetermined 10% non-inferiority margin. CONCLUSIONS: The i-view device failed to meet our predetermined non-inferiority margin when compared to the reusable VL systems with the study stopping early due to futility. Significant crossover occurred at the discretion of the intubating operator during the i-view month.

BACKGROUND: Total intubation time (TIT) is an objective indicator of tracheal intubation (TI) difficulties. However, large variations in TIT because of diverse initial and end targets make it difficult to compare studies. A video laryngoscope (VLS) can capture images during the TI process. By using artificial intelligence (AI) to detect airway structures, the start and end points can be freely selected, thus eliminating the inconsistencies. Further deconstructing the process and establishing time-sequence analysis may aid in gaining further understanding of the TI process. METHODS: We developed a time-sequencing system for analyzing TI performed using a #3 Macintosh VLS. This system was established and validated on 30 easy TIs performed by specialists and validated using TI videos performed by a postgraduate-year (PGY) physician. Thirty easy intubation videos were selected from a cohort approved by our institutional review board (B-ER-107-088), and 6 targets were labeled: the lip, epiglottis, laryngopharynx, glottic opening, tube tip, and a black line on the endotracheal tube. We used 887 captured images to develop an AI model trained using You Only Look Once, Version 3 (YOLOv3). Seven cut points were selected for phase division. Seven experts selected the cut points. The expert cut points were used to validate the AI-identified cut points and time-sequence data. After the removal of the tube tip and laryngopharynx images, the durations between 5 identical cut points and sequentially identified the durations of 4 intubation phases, as well as TIT. RESULTS: The average and total losses approached 0 within 150 cycles of model training for target identification. The identification rate for all cut points was 92.4% (194 of 210), which increased to 99.4% (179 of 180) after the removal of the tube tip target. The 4 phase durations and TIT calculated by the AI model and those from the expert exhibited strong Pearson correlation (phase I, r = 0.914; phase II, r = 0.868; phase III, r = 0.964; and phase IV, r = 0.949; TIT, r = 0.99; all P < .001). Similar findings were obtained for the PGY's observations (r > 0.95; P < .01). CONCLUSIONS: YOLOv3 is a powerful tool for analyzing images recorded by VLS. By using AI to detect the airway structures, the start and end points can be freely selected, resolving the heterogeneity resulting from the inconsistencies in the TIT cut points across studies. Time-sequence analysis involving the deconstruction of VLS-recorded TI images into several phases should be conducted in further TI research.

Aspiration of gastric contents is a recognised complication during all phases of anaesthesia. The risk of this event becomes more likely with repeated attempts at tracheal intubation. There is a lack of clinical data on the effectiveness of videolaryngoscopy relative to direct laryngoscopy rapid sequence intubation in the operating theatre. We hypothesised that the use of a videolaryngoscope during rapid sequence intubation would be associated with a higher first pass tracheal intubation success rate than conventional direct laryngoscopy. In this multicentre randomised controlled trial, 1000 adult patients requiring tracheal intubation for elective, urgent or emergency surgery were allocated randomly to airway management using a McGrath™ MAC videolaryngoscope (Medtronic, Minneapolis, MN, USA) or direct laryngoscopy. Both techniques used a Macintosh blade. First-pass tracheal intubation success was higher in patients allocated to the McGrath group (470/500, 94%) compared with those allocated to the direct laryngoscopy group (358/500, 71.6%), odds ratio (95%CI) 1.31 (1.23-1.39); p < 0.001. This advantage was observed in both trainees and consultants. Cormack and Lehane grade ≥ 3 view occurred less frequently in patients allocated to the McGrath group compared with those allocated to the direct laryngoscopy group (5/500, 1% vs. 94/500, 19%, respectively; p < 0.001). Tracheal intubation with a McGrath videolaryngoscope was associated with a lower rate of adverse events compared with direct laryngoscopy (13/500, 2.6% vs. 61/500, 12.2%, respectively; p < 0.001). These findings suggest that the McGrath videolaryngoscope is superior to a conventional direct laryngoscope for rapid sequence intubation in the operating theatre.

OBJECTIVE: To describe initial experience with use of the Glidescope Go videolaryngoscope by an Australian neonatal pre-hospital and retrieval service. METHODS: We conducted a 31-month retrospective review of an airway registry for neonates intubated by MedSTAR Kids clinicians. RESULTS: Twenty-two patients were intubated using the Glidescope Go, compared with 50 using direct laryngoscopy. First-pass success was 17/22 (77.3%) with the Glidescope Go and 38/50 (76%) with direct laryngoscopy. Complications occurred in 7/22 (32%) and 8/50 (16%), respectively. CONCLUSIONS: On initial review of this practice change, videolaryngoscopy allows neonatal tracheal intubation with a comparable success rate to direct laryngoscopy in a pre-hospital and retrieval setting.

Hyperangulated videolaryngoscopes are known to increase the success rate of tracheal intubation in the setting of difficult airway management when used with a stylet or bougie. However, there is controversy over which adjunct is more useful. This randomised study aimed to compare first attempt tracheal intubation success rate between a stylet and bougie when using a hyperangulated videolaryngoscope. We recruited patients aged > 20 years who were scheduled for elective surgery under general anaesthesia and required tracheal intubation. We only included patients with factors predicting difficult tracheal intubation based on pre-anaesthesia airway evaluation. Tracheal intubation was attempted using a Glidescope® with either a stylet or bougie as an adjunct according to group assignment. Primary outcome was the success rate of the first tracheal intubation attempt, and secondary outcomes were success of second and third attempts; tracheal intubation time; and occurrence of sore throat, dysphagia or hoarseness. A total of 166 patients were included. The success rate of the first tracheal intubation attempt was significantly higher in patients allocated to the bougie group compared with those allocated to the stylet group (81/83 (98%) vs. 73/83 (88%), respectively; p = 0.032). The number of patients who needed two attempts was significantly lower in those allocated to the bougie group compared with those allocated to the stylet group (1/83 (1%) vs. 9/83 (11%), respectively; p = 0.018). Each group had one patient (1%) where tracheal intubation was achieved after a third attempt. There was no significant difference in the occurrence of sore throat, dysphagia and hoarseness between the two groups. When difficult tracheal intubation is anticipated and a hyperangulated videolaryngoscope is used, the success rate of the first attempt is higher when a bougie is used compared with a stylet.

Difficult airway management poses a great challenge for clinicians, especially if it is unanticipated. Numerous guidelines and a wide array of devices constitute the anesthesiologist's armamentarium for managing the airway. When the use of individual devices fails, the use of combination techniques is advised. We present a case of difficult intubation in a 50-year-old male patient scheduled for aortic valve replacement. He had no prior history of difficult airway management, and no abnormalities were detected on preoperative airway assessment. Body mass index was 29 kg/m2. After the separate use of direct laryngoscopy, videolaryngoscopy and a BONFILS intubation endoscope (BIE) had failed, we resorted to a combination technique, combining videolaryngoscopy and BIE. While the videolaryngoscope provided the space needed for BIE and visual guidance through copious secretions, the BIE served as a stylet for endotracheal tube guidance, leading to successful intubation. Since the technique requires costly equipment, experience in handling it and at least two operators, it is more appropriate as a rescue measure than an elective procedure. Given the potentially disastrous outcomes of failed intubation, mastering advanced airway management techniques remains of vital importance, and the combination technique is one of them.
